Parsippany CDP, New Jersey at a Glance
Parsippany CDP is a neighborhood in New Jersey with a population of approximately 21,806. The median home value is $517,500 and the median household income is $102,074. It has a Walk Score of 25 out of 100, indicating car dependency. The violent crime rate is 0.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 92% below the national average. Air quality is rated Good. The overall climate risk is rated as "Relatively High." Median rent is $1,625 per month. Data sourced from the US Census Bureau, FBI Crime Data Explorer, EPA, Walk Score, and FEMA.
